What is the difference between Entry Level Tactical Role Player vs Entry Level Security Officer?

AspectEntry Level Tactical Role PlayerEntry Level Security Officer
Required CredentialsBasic security or tactical training, possibly certifications in first aid or CPRSecurity guard license, basic training
Work EnvironmentSimulated tactical scenarios, training facilities, or event settingsCommercial, residential, or event security sites
Employer & Industry UsageMilitary, law enforcement training, private security firmsSecurity companies, corporate buildings, retail stores
Search & Comparison IntentUnderstanding tactical training roles, simulation jobsSecurity job opportunities, entry-level security roles

Entry Level Tactical Role Players focus on tactical training and simulations, often within military or law enforcement contexts, requiring specific tactical certifications. Entry Level Security Officers primarily provide security services at various sites, with basic security credentials. While both roles involve security-related work, Tactical Role Players emphasize training scenarios, whereas Security Officers focus on physical security and surveillance.
